Meet the Bishops: Get to know a little about Ruthie Silberman of the Ohio Wesleyan women's tennis team.
Class Year: 2022
Major: Early Childhood Education
How/Why did you choose Ohio Wesleyan?
I chose Ohio Wesleyan because they get you working with kids in the classroom right away. I also wanted to play tennis.
How/Why did you choose your major?
I've had a variety of jobs working with kids in the past, such as a teacher's assistant in a preschool classroom and babysitting, and I love helping kids learn!
What is your number one goal, personal or team, for this season?
My number one goal for this season is to play the best I can and to know I put in my best effort.
Why did you choose to compete in sports at Ohio Wesleyan?
I chose to compete in sports in college because I competed in sports throughout high school and I wanted to continue that.
What are your strengths as an athlete?
My strengths as an athlete are my strategy and endurance.
